This is hilarious. I got a letter from the finance company today. They're complaining that I didn't title the car in a timely manner.
According to their records, as of April 14, Shift had sent me everything I needed to title the car.
First of all, I only signed the final purchase agreement on April 14th. That was literally the day this all started, legally speaking.
Second of all, Shift didn't send me enough of anything to title the car, specifically so they could make sure the lender was correctly listed as the lienholder.
Besides all that, today is July 15th. I got the final title, with the correct lienholder, on June 3rd. It's been three months since this all began, and over a month since the title was completed. But they still felt the need to send me this letter.
TD Auto Finance seems to be almost as incompetent as Shift. It's no wonder they work together.
